31 MyPLC is a complete PlanetLab Central (PLC) portable installation
32 contained within a chroot jail. The default installation consists of a
33 web server, an XML-RPC API server, a boot server, and a database
34 server: the core components of PLC. All PLC services are started up and
35 shut down through a single System V init script installed in the host
36 system. The related Web Interface is now separately packaged
37 in the PLCWWW component.

92 # Old versions of myplc used to ship with a bootstrapped database and
93 # /etc/planetlab directory. Including generated files in the manifest
94 # was dangerous; if /plc/data/var/lib/pgsql/data/base/1/16676 changed
95 # names from one RPM build to another, it would be rpmsaved and thus
96 # effectively deleted. Now we do not include these files in the
97 # manifest. However, to avoid deleting these files in the process of
98 # upgrading from one of these old versions of myplc, we must back up
99 # the database and /etc/planetlab and restore them after the old
100 # version has been uninstalled in %triggerpostun (also in %post, in
101 # case we are force upgrading to the same version).
103 # This code can be removed once all myplc-0.4-1 installations have
104 # been upgraded to at least myplc-0.4-2.
